>  Is it unreasonable of me to expect that *any* format supported in a
>  Bazaar release (despite "no-one was supposed to use" it) should be
>  upgrade supported in later versions?

If a given format were labeled as experimental then yes I think the
expectation of that support would be excessive.

I think it's great that the opportunity to try new formats is
available (for users planning a future migration and for the project
needing more exposure for testing) but for those formats, the project
shouldn't be burdened unconditionally with complete support.  That
lack of support should also, of course, not burden users by failing to
communicate to them the experimental nature of a given option.

Did the help for 'init-repo' clearly explain the experimental nature
of the format in that version?
